SB0192

AN ACT to amend Tennessee Code Annotated, Title 57, relative to alcoholic beverages.

Complete·3/30/26

Tennessee SB0192 reduces the number of credible witnesses required for certain alcoholic beverage violations from two to one.

Tennessee SB0192 amends the state's code concerning alcoholic beverages by changing the requirement from two credible witnesses to one for certain violations. This act takes effect immediately upon becoming law, as deemed necessary for public welfare.
